We LOVE our central vac !! The super long hose easily reaches the whole interior of the 5th wheel. The hose stores neatly in a box that fits in our closet and takes up much less room than a regular vacuum. The coolest part is that under the step leading to the front bedroom is an opening where you sweep the kitchen floor and push your pile up to it and the central vac will suck it up :D

Any unit built around or after January 06 will have the dust pan pick-up in the step going up to the bedroom and the pick-up outlet for the hose on that same wall going up to the bedroom.

The unit is mounted on the compartment floor near the water pump, you can also connect a hose into the unit outside also if needed to cleanup your compartment. The unit comes with a extra bag and Camping World has the bags also 2 or 3 for a couple bucks.
